commentFUNCTION Responsible for the deacetylation of lysine residues on the N-terminal part of the core histones (H2A, H2B, H3 and H4). Histone deacetylation gives a tag for epigenetic repression and plays an important role in transcriptional regulation, cell cycle progression and developmental events. Histone deacetylases act via the formation of large multiprotein complexes.CATALYTIC ACTIVITY N(6)-acetyl-L-lysyl-[histone] + H2O = L-lysyl-[histone] + acetateSUBUNIT Interacts with HDAC6.INTERACTION Weakly expressed in most tissues. Strongly expressed in brain, heart, skeletal muscle, kidney and testis.MISCELLANEOUS Its activity is inhibited by trapoxin, a known histone deacetylase inhibitor.SIMILARITY Belongs to the histone deacetylase family.SEQUENCE CAUTION Truncated C-terminus.
